Sweetwater, the nation's number one online retailer of music instruments and pro audio gear, is seeking to hire an analytical, detailed, and enthusiastic Distribution Center Operations Analyst to join our growing Analytical team! In this role, you will serve as an embedded operational analytics partner within the fulfillment operation. You will focus on improving labor efficiency, operational visibility, process flow, and execution consistency across inbound, outbound, inventory, FBA fulfillment, and support functions.


You will play a critical role in our environment (operating on internally developed systems) where operational visibility, exception identification, and workflow analysis require hands-on operational understanding in addition to analytical capability. This role supports proactive labor and throughput management, identifies operational constraints and trends, develops reporting and dashboards, and partners with leadership to drive continuous improvement


Job Responsibilities

  • Develop and maintain operational dashboards, reporting, and KPI visibility across inbound, outbound, inventory, and support functions
  • Analyze labor utilization, productivity, throughput, backlog, SLA performance, and operational trends to support leadership decision-making
  • Identify operational bottlenecks, exception trends, system gaps, and process inefficiencies
  • Partner with Labor Planning & Operations Leadership to support proactive labor allocation and operational balancing
  • Support root cause analysis for service failures, delayed orders, inventory discrepancies, and workflow disruptions
  • Collaborate with Industrial Engineering on process optimization initiatives, workflow studies, and operational improvement efforts
  • Develop and maintain ad hoc analysis, operational scorecards, and executive summaries

Qualifications

  • Bachelor's Degree in Business, Supply Chain, Analytics, Industrial Engineering, Operations, or related field
  • Advanced experience in data analysis, specifically related to fulfillment, distribution, or supply chain operations
  • Expert knowledge in data tools such as Excel, SQL, and BI tools (Looker, Power BI, Tableau etc.)
  • 2-4 + years of experience in fulfillment, distribution, or operational analytics environments
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ills
  • Ability to turn data into actionable items for business improvements
